Build Your Tool Kit

Blow Dryer

+Multiple Heat & Speed Settings +Nozzle +Diffuser Min Watt 1875

Flat Iron

+Multiple Heat Settings +Friction Free plates with slightly rounded edge. (a right angle edge can crimp hair)

Curling Iron

+Multiple Heat Settings +Friction Free barrel

Round Brush

+Medium- Large size +Metal Barrel for Volume/Control

Velcro Rollers

+Medium/Large/Extra Large (longer hair use larger rollers, curlier or fuller set size down)

Little Bits & Bobs

+Sectioning Clips +Hair Ties +Bobby Pins +Accessories (headbands, scarves, ornamental/floral pins and clips)

Tips

Photo of hands holding hair styling tools.
  • Always use a heat protectant when blow drying or ironing 
  • Blow dry without brush until 80-90% dry to avoid stretching the hair when it’s most elastic
  • Pick one heat styling method/ per day(ish) either blow dry or air dry and iron (ideally)

How to Diffuse Curls

The same principals apply to air drying curls, just skip the heat, and do not disturb until dry. You can also air dry until 70% or so and speed it up the rest of the way with the diffuser.

* I do not recommend leaving your hair wet for extended periods. The “longest” you should let your hair stay wet is ideally just a few hours; it’s also best to try to dry your hair completely before going to sleep to minimize the risk of breakage and scalp irritation from prolonged wetness.
